English: This wheel bug nymph is attacking a silver-spotted skipper caterpillar. Wheel bugs are a type of assassin bug. They use their beak-like mouthparts to inject toxin into their prey's body, immobilizing the prey before feeding on its body fluids. The silver-spotted skipper will feed on soybeans, but rarely causes significant damage.

Created by: Ian Grettenberger

Wheel bug (Arilus cristatus, Hemiptera:Reduviidae) Caterpillar (Epargyreus clarus, Lepidoptera: Hesperiidae
